CVE-2019-19802 describes an improper authorization vulnerability in Gallagher Command Centre Server versions prior to v8.10.1134(MR4), v8.00.1161(MR5), v7.90.991(MR5), v7.80.960(MR2), and v7.70 or earlier. An authenticated user connecting via OPCUA can access all data typically replicated in a multi-server environment, bypassing intended privilege checks. This medium-severity vulnerability (CVSS 6.5) allows for high confidentiality impact without requiring user interaction, though it necessitates prior authentication. There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
